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96122555909 730884 29 0675154
62 135414
62 135414
912362965 21771 795897
All about undefined
Interested in learning more?
62 135414
912362965 21771 795897
See more
06649240 372848 80153583548
623 874120 522
See more
321179093 8186712 687
63357114043 9126 96 6591837 248733289
See more